Program Overview

The Architerrax Fellowship Program offers architecture students a prestigious opportunity to learn, collaborate, and connect globally. Created to support growth in architectural knowledge and professional networking, this program immerses participants in dynamic activities and discussions, advancing both their practical skills and theoretical understanding of architecture.

Program Benefits

Participants will expand their grasp of architectural concepts through an exploration of design principles, historical influences, and sustainable practices. Through a range of activities that emphasize presentation and critical thinking, students will refine their communication and design abilities, fostering professional development within an encouraging environment. Connecting with students from around the world, participants will also establish a global network, enhancing their academic and professional pursuits.

Enrollment Process

To enroll in the Architerrax Fellowship Program, students are invited to complete an online application form that includes their personal details, academic background, and a brief statement outlining their interest in the program. Following the application review, selected candidates will be invited to an online interview, designed to facilitate a mutual understanding of fit and program expectations. Upon selection, participants will receive an acceptance letter, followed by a comprehensive orientation that details the program structure, key expectations, and upcoming activities.

Program Structure

Structured to include regular online meetings, the program encompasses engaging discussions and hands-on activities focusing on topics such as design presentations, architectural critiques, and collaborative research. Participants will have the opportunity to work closely with a diverse team of students, guided by a dedicated team coordinator who ensures meaningful and thought-provoking interactions.
